A number of community grants have been announced today for not-for-profit community groups providing support to Australian Defence Force families.

Minister for Defence, the Hon Christopher Pyne MP, said $1.4 million in grants would assist with delivering activities and services of value to Defence families across Australia.

“This funding will help Defence personnel and their families engage with their local communities, support their wellbeing and provide access to information for managing the demands of military life, such as the impact of frequent postings and deployments” Minister Pyne said.

Minister for Defence Personnel, the Hon Darren Chester MP said a variety of programs supported through the grants would enable Defence families to connect and interact with each other and the community in a variety of ways.

“This funding contributes to the formation of solid social foundations and a support network for those facing the challenges a posting can bring,” Mr Chester said.

The 38 grant recipients manage a broad range of activities across all states and territories.

The grants program is managed by the Defence Community Organisation, which provides a wide range of programs, information and assistance for Defence families.
